Output 0cc59ec430b27a8e119eacb5563053a401ee7c232922df84d0d8338350da9058:1

value
640946
script pubkey
OP_0 OP_PUSHBYTES_20 75369c1b14114351122bdfb4c4aea458e1f3b1a7
address
bc1qw5mfcxc5z9p4zy3tm76vft4ytrsl8vd8h5gj7c
transaction
0cc59ec430b27a8e119eacb5563053a401ee7c232922df84d0d8338350da9058
spent
true